         <description><![CDATA[<div><strong>1791</strong><br>Antoine Lavoisier proved Georg Stahl's theory false. The theory proposed that when things are burned, they release and invisible fluid called "phlogiston." Lavoisier instead proved that oxygen from the air is gained during combustion rather than a loss of fluid.</div>]]></description>

         <description><![CDATA[<div><strong>1714<br></strong>Gabriel Fahrenheit created a mercury-filled thermometer based on the boiling and freezing points of water.<br><strong>1742</strong><br>Anders Celsius created a similar thermometer but separated the intervals in 100 equal divisions.</div>]]></description>
